- This advanced mode also allows to create “obstacle filter” that consist in masking obstacles echoes that disrupt the
measure like in the case of invert channel or ladder
rungs present in the field of view of the sensor.
After clicking on “Create an obstacle filter”, you need to choose with the tick box the obstacle matching the wanted
measure (water height), press “Create”.
- Once the filter has been made and checked, you need to confirm it by clicking the button “Launch a new measure”,
then adjust either the H or the H2 to ensure the quality of water height measurements.
Finally, this advanced mode allows two other particularly efficient optimization and filtering operations.
One computation parameter often named “oblique filter” works as follow:
- Choose a Filter y-axis of 160
- Adjust the filter slope until it becomes parallel to the power indicator (yellow line) and ends to the zero of the sensors.
- If you can’t see that oblique filter, adjust the y-axis.
The integrations count option, available for minimum, average and maximum, is the successive
ultrasonic shoots
treatment (3 by default). The average option calculates the average of those shoots. Most of the time the maximum
option is to be chosen to get reliable measurements (and especially in presence of condensation) but also depends of
the power setting of the sensor.
